2. Types of Cryptocurrency Applications
2.1 Mobile Cryptocurrency Wallets
Mobile cryptocurrency wallets are among the most popular types of cryptocurrency applications. These wallets allow users to store, send, and receive cryptocurrencies directly from their smartphones. They are categorized into hot wallets (online) and cold wallets (offline).
2.2 Cryptocurrency Exchanges
Cryptocurrency exchanges are platforms where users can buy, sell, and trade various cryptocurrencies. These exchanges can be web-based or mobile applications, and they offer a wide range of features, such as real-time market data, advanced charting tools, and trading pairs.
2.3 Cryptocurrency Mining Software
Cryptocurrency mining software is used by individuals and organizations to mine new coins by solving complex mathematical algorithms. This software runs on computers and requires significant computing power and energy.
2.4 Cryptocurrency Trading Platforms
Cryptocurrency trading platforms are similar to stock exchanges, where users can buy and sell cryptocurrencies. These platforms offer various features, such as limit orders, stop orders, and margin trading.
2.5 Cryptocurrency Investment Apps
Cryptocurrency investment apps help users invest in various cryptocurrencies and tokens. These apps often provide educational resources, investment strategies, and portfolio management tools.
2.6 Cryptocurrency Payment Solutions
Cryptocurrency payment solutions enable users to make purchases and transactions using cryptocurrencies. These solutions can be integrated into e-commerce platforms, mobile applications, and even physical retail stores.
2.7 Cryptocurrency Analytics and Research Tools
Cryptocurrency analytics and research tools provide users with valuable information about the market, such as price charts, trading volumes, and historical data. These tools help users make informed decisions about their investments.
2.8 Cryptocurrency Gaming
Cryptocurrency gaming apps allow users to earn cryptocurrencies while playing games. These apps often use blockchain technology to ensure transparency and security.
3. Mobile Cryptocurrency Wallets
Mobile cryptocurrency wallets have become increasingly popular due to their convenience and ease of use. Some of the most popular mobile wallets include:
- Trust Wallet: A multi-currency wallet that supports over 50 cryptocurrencies.
- Ledger Nano S: A hardware wallet that provides offline storage for cryptocurrencies.
- Exodus: A user-friendly mobile wallet that supports multiple cryptocurrencies.
4. Cryptocurrency Exchanges
Cryptocurrency exchanges are essential for users who want to trade cryptocurrencies. Some of the most popular exchanges include:
- Binance: A leading cryptocurrency exchange with a user-friendly interface and a wide range of trading pairs.
- Coinbase: A well-known exchange that offers a simple and secure platform for buying and selling cryptocurrencies.
- Kraken: A popular exchange with advanced trading features and a strong focus on security.
5. Cryptocurrency Mining Software
Several cryptocurrency mining software options are available for individuals and organizations. Some of the most popular mining software includes:
- CGMiner: An open-source mining software that supports various cryptocurrencies.
- NiceHash: A cloud mining platform that allows users to mine cryptocurrencies using remote servers.
- BitMinter: A mining pool that provides users with the necessary tools to mine cryptocurrencies.
6. Cryptocurrency Trading Platforms
Cryptocurrency trading platforms offer users various trading tools and features to manage their investments. Some of the most popular trading platforms include:
- BitMEX: A high-frequency trading platform that offers advanced trading features and leverage.
- Huobi: A leading cryptocurrency exchange with a dedicated trading platform for professional traders.
- Bybit: A popular trading platform that offers leverage trading and derivatives trading.
7. Cryptocurrency Investment Apps
Cryptocurrency investment apps help users invest in various cryptocurrencies and tokens. Some of the most popular investment apps include:
- Coinbase Pro: A professional-grade trading platform that offers advanced trading features and access to various cryptocurrencies.
- eToro: A social trading platform that allows users to copy the trades of successful traders.
- Coinbase Wallet: A mobile wallet that provides users with a secure way to store and manage their cryptocurrencies.
8. Cryptocurrency Payment Solutions
Cryptocurrency payment solutions have become increasingly popular, with several platforms offering seamless integration into e-commerce websites and mobile applications. Some of the most popular payment solutions include:
- Coinbase Commerce: A payment processing platform that allows merchants to accept cryptocurrencies.
- BitPay: A payment service that enables businesses to accept cryptocurrencies as payment.
- BlockFi: A platform that offers interest-bearing cryptocurrency accounts and payment solutions.
9. Cryptocurrency Analytics and Research Tools
Cryptocurrency analytics and research tools provide users with valuable information to make informed decisions about their investments. Some of the most popular tools include:
- CoinMarketCap: A platform that provides real-time data on the market cap, volume, and price of various cryptocurrencies.
- TradingView: A platform that offers advanced charting tools, technical indicators, and community trading ideas.
- CryptoCompare: A platform that provides comprehensive data on cryptocurrencies, including price charts, market cap, and trading volume.
10. Cryptocurrency Gaming
Cryptocurrency gaming apps offer users a unique way to earn cryptocurrencies while enjoying their favorite games. Some of the most popular gaming apps include:
- Axie Infinity: A blockchain-based game that allows players to collect, breed, and battle digital creatures called Axies.
- The Sandbox: A virtual world where users can create, experience, and monetize their own digital worlds.
- Decentraland: A virtual reality platform where users can buy, sell, and monetize digital assets.

Questions and Answers
1. What is a cryptocurrency wallet?
- A cryptocurrency wallet is a digital tool used to store, send, and receive cryptocurrencies.
2. How can I choose the right cryptocurrency wallet?
- Consider the type of wallet (hot or cold), the number of cryptocurrencies supported, and the level of security offered.
3. What is the difference between a cryptocurrency exchange and a trading platform?
- Cryptocurrency exchanges are platforms for buying and selling cryptocurrencies, while trading platforms are platforms for trading cryptocurrencies against other assets.
4. What are the risks of cryptocurrency mining?
- The risks include high energy consumption, hardware costs, and the volatility of cryptocurrency prices.
5. How can I protect my cryptocurrency investments?
- Use strong passwords, enable two-factor authentication, and keep your private keys secure.
